Here are some family-friendly ideas that can be reached in a comfortable day trip from Verfeuil:</p> <h3>Nature and Scenic Walks</h3> <p>The Gard region offers scenic rivers, shaded trails, and gentle hikes suitable for children. Easy walking paths along the Gardon or Cèze rivers allow for birdwatching, picnicking, and occasional rock-hopping adventures that are safe in the hands of attentive adults. Short nature walks near villages often end with a stop at a local bakery or café for a refreshing treat.</p> <h3>Iconic Nearby Sights for a Family Day</h3> <p>Verfeuil’s location makes it a convenient gateway to some of southern France’s most beloved family attractions:</p> <ul> <li>Pont du Gard: The ancient Roman aqueduct is a memorable, easy-to-navigate site with expansive lawns for family picnics and gentle riverside strolls.</li> <li>Nîmes: A city rich in Roman history, featuring an amphitheatre, a beautiful courtyard, and gardens that are engaging for kids and adults alike.</li> <li>Uzès: A charming medieval town known for its market, the duchy architecture, and family-friendly walking routes through narrow lanes and shaded squares.</li> <li>La Bambouseraie in Anduze: A botanical garden with bamboo groves and safe, stroller-friendly paths that feel like a mini adventure in a private forest.</li> </ul> <h3>Water-Focused Fun</h3> <p>Southern France’s warm summers invite family-friendly water activities. Consider a day of gentle swimming or paddle-boarding in calm coves or resort pools, followed by a hillside picnic. When near rivers or lakes, always follow local safety guidelines, supervise children closely, and respect posted rules about swimming and water depth.</p> <h2>Local Experiences: Food, Culture, and Hands-On Family Fun</h2> <p>Occitanie is not only about landscapes; it’s a region of rich flavors and welcoming communities. The following tips help ensure a successful stay in Verfeuil and the Gard area:</p> <h3>Getting There and Getting Around</h3> <p>Most families reach Verfeuil by car, with convenient routes from Toulouse, Montpellier, or Nîmes. If you’re flying in, consider nearby airports in Nîmes–Alès–Camargue or Avignon; then rent a vehicle suitable for your group size. A car is highly recommended for families to allow flexible day trips, easy packing of gear, and safe transport of children and strollers. When choosing accommodations, prioritize parking access and a short walk from the door to the vehicle to minimize lugging luggage and kids across streets.</p> <h3>Safety and Comfort First</h3> <p>In any vacation rental, verify safety basics before arrival.
